How do tick charts and time charts differ in their ability to predict cryptocurrency price trends?

- İlker CihanMar 22, 2025 · 5 months agoTick charts and time charts have different ways of representing price data, which can affect their ability to predict cryptocurrency price trends. Tick charts show price changes based on the number of trades that occur, while time charts show price changes over a specific time period, such as minutes or hours. Tick charts can provide more granular and real-time information about price movements, which can be useful for short-term trading strategies. On the other hand, time charts can provide a broader view of price trends over longer periods, allowing traders to identify patterns and make informed decisions. Both types of charts have their advantages and disadvantages, and it ultimately depends on the trader's trading style and goals.
